14:22 — The metrics-aggregation sidecar on the Lorvane fleet began dropping batches after a config push doubled the flush interval. Oncall (Mirela) observed queue depth climbing on the Tabrin dashboard but no alerts fired, since thresholds were tuned for the old interval. We rolled back the config at 14:41 and confirmed recovery by 14:55. For cross-referencing with the deploy logs discussed in sync, the exact rollback build is noted below.

pipeline stamp: htk9_ce63042d9

## Releases

ShelfStream publishes catalogue-import builds monthly. Plugin authors must target the import schema pinned in each release tag; MARC-variant mappings change between minors, so re-run the Stackwise conformance suite before publishing. Unsigned plugin bundles are rejected by the registry. All official ShelfStream artifacts are signed; verify downloads before building against them using the key below.

release key, yafof-kadup: bky4_soBk

## Deploying the Gatewick Proctor Queue

Deploys are pretty painless: push to main, wait for the pipeline, then watch the queue drain dashboard for five minutes. If candidates pile up mid-exam, roll back first and ask questions later — the queue replays safely. Everything the workers care about lives in one config block, shown here for reference.

settings of bafof-yagef:
JOROX_PIN=8740
JOROX_TENANT=pelox
JOROX_METRICS_HOST=metrics.jorox.qorvelworks.internal
JOROX_SEAL=seal_c78f63c1
JOROX_STANDBY_TEAM=norax

// Broker upgrade notes for plugin authors:
// Quillbus 4.x replaces the legacy 3.x wire protocol. Plugins must
// construct the client with explicit protocol negotiation enabled,
// or connections to the Larkfield cluster will be silently downgraded
// and dropped after 30s. Topic names are unchanged. For local testing
// against the sandbox broker, authenticate with the key below.

API key for bafof-bagaf: qvz2-qi